Learn Elixir or something else that is more adequate for distributed systems or microservices.


For microservices and distributed system I think is better to start with the basics of the architecture and design patterns than with a specific language. I can recommend you two books that I am currently reading:

But it's also more fun in building something in a new language and learn in the process.

